    Principle of Micro Bubble Cleaning Technology

    An innovative solution to overcome the chronic limitations of existing cleaning methods is Huvics’ micro bubble cleaning technology. This technology is based on the principle of generating a large number of ultrafine bubbles, measuring less than tens of micrometers (μm), in a liquid. These ultrafine bubbles penetrate deeply between particles delicately attached to the contaminated surface, reaching areas unseen by the naked eye. As the bubbles burst, the resulting powerful ‘cavitation’ phenomenon effectively separates and removes contaminant particles from the substrate without physical damage. It is a scientific process that drastically reduces defect rates by perfectly removing even micro contaminants invisible to the naked eye, without posing any threat to semiconductor substrates.     The Risks of Incomplete Drying

    No matter how perfect the removal of micro contaminants during the cleaning process, if the subsequent drying process is incomplete, the efforts so far may become futile. This is because residual micro moisture or volatile foreign substances left on the sensor surface can become new contaminants over time or critically affect the functions of precise sensors. It’s akin to how a cleaned dish with remaining moisture creates an environment conducive to microbial growth.

    Oven Dry Function and Flexible Operation Method

    The innovative ‘Oven Dry’ function equipped in Huvics’ cleaner system is designed to fundamentally block such problems. Beyond mere drying, this function ensures complete evaporation and removal of even trace amounts of moisture that may remain on the product surface after cleaning through precise temperature control and efficient air circulation. This prevents secondary contamination and helps maintain the optimal dry state before the sensor is mounted.
